Suns G Washington Jr. out; Mavs F Wood in

Dec 5, 2022, 4:45 PM | Updated: 4:51 pm

Phoenix Suns guard Duane Washington Jr. (hip) will join three rotation players on his team who will not suit up Monday against the Dallas Mavericks.

Point guard Chris Paul (heel soreness) along with forwards Torrey Craig (groin strain) and Cam Johnson (meniscus recovery) remain out for Phoenix.

The Suns face a Mavs (11-11) team that will have forward Christian Wood, who is Dallas’ second-leading scorer behind Luka Doncic and was questionable with a non-COVID illness.

The Suns (16-7) also list forward Jae Crowder on the injury report as he remains away from the team as it looks to trade him.

With Johnson and Craig out following Crowder’s unofficial departure, Dario Saric has entered the rotation in a starting role for the past two games. He played 21 minutes in each of those games and scored a season-high 17 with three rebounds and two assists on Sunday.

Suns head coach Monty Williams has gone deep into his frontcourt options lately, playing reserves Ish Wainright, Josh Okogie, Jock Landale and Bismack Biyombo.

In the backcourt, Washington has been in and out of the rotation since Paul’s injury on Nov. 7. Washington did play briefly in a blowout of the San Antonio Spurs on Sunday as Williams rested the starters in the fourth quarter.

Phoenix will start Cam Payne and Devin Booker at guard, with Landry Shamet and Damion Lee garnering minutes behind them.
